Regular reader are probably familiar with a phrase I use in my blogs rather often.

"Gainfully employed."

This phrase refers to productive members of society.

They are employed and they are rewarded with financial gains.

Then, what is the word I use for myself?

"Unemployed."

This is probably the correct description of AK to most people which is also why they are usually dumbfounded at least for a while before they make some polite noises.




On my part, I also like this phrase to describe myself because of its economy since I am too lazy to provide any explanation to anyone who might be curious enough to probe further.

Of course, our government knows the truth about AK.

"Unemployed" refers to someone who is actively looking for employment but has been unsuccessful.

AK isn't looking for employment and has not been looking for employment for almost 8 years now.

So, the government has a phrase for people like AK.

"Economically inactive."

If we are somewhat sensitive to the choice of words, we might feel that there is a little bit of negative undertone in the word "inactive."

It is like the word "lazy" but just a little better. 

"Economically lazy?"

To be honest, I rather like that.




Recently, I have been thinking of telling people that I am "gainfully unemployed."

If you think there is a perverse streak in me, you are probably correct.

Telling people I am "gainfully unemployed" should confuse some people, especially those who have been institutionalized by the hamster wheel that is employment.

"You unemployed?"

"What you gain?"

"You crazy or what?"

OK, can I choose not to answer that question?

I mean, being an IMH patient, there is a very easy way to answer that question, after all.




In my more lucid moments, I might deign to give a socially acceptable answer which might go like this.

"By being unemployed, I gain a lot of free time and the freedom to do whatever I want, answering to nobody but myself."

Hi EX,

It is not uncommon to see people jumping into marriage, purchasing a home and having children very early on in life.

I know some people don't like it when I say we should defer marriage plans and when I share what my attitude is towards having children.

However, unless we have money gushing in all the time, we have to decide what to prioritize with limited resources.

References:
1. A happy marriage is worth waiting for.
2. How to have children and a comfortable retirement?

Anyway, I am probably digressing.

Have the basics in personal finance settled first before thinking about investing.

Financial security comes first.

See:
Take steps towards financial security.

Then, start investing and if we are risk averse, investing for income is a perfect fit.

Once our investments are able to generate sufficient passive income regularly to meet our basic needs, we can let up a bit if we wish to.

We don't have to feel that we must always be buying stocks.

There will be times when Mr. Market is depressed and that is when we can invest more and save less.

When Mr. Market is feeling exuberant, we invest less and save more.

There isn't a fixed formula per se.
